18.1 Legacy Series / Windows Update Error 0x801901f7
« on: March 04, 2018, 01:19:10 am »
Hi,

I am hoping that someone can suggest how to fix this error.

Ever since updating to v18.x I have been unable to access windows update for windows 10. I get the error:
"There were some problems installing updates, but we’ll try again later. If you keep seeing this and want to search the web or contact support for information, this may help: (0x801901f7)"

I have tried adding the various WU server addresses to the SSL 'No Bump' list, I have tried turning off IPS (that seems to crash the system and requires that I reload services from the console or reboot the system).
I am running Squid, IPS and ClamAV, all with the latest OPNsense versions. I have also done a full, clean, install of OPNsense, regenerated certs and installed them on the PC. I still get the same error.

I have read various posts on here regarding similar problems but have not found any solutions that work for me.

Hoping someone can suggest something that I have not tried???
